The Reds finally won this weekend. They were better than Ipswich on the road, 0-2, snapping back-to-back games that ended in a tie. Alexander Isak scored twice inside the first 9 minutes of the game, both times on Cody Gakpo’s assist.
It’s vital for Liverpool that the Swedish striker gets into good form early, because Iraola has to start posting good results immediately. Competition in both the Premier League and the Champions League is tough.
After two wins and a tie in the Spanish La Liga, Atletico lost the most recent event, and may we say it, pretty confidently. The Mattress Makers went to Bilbao, where the hosts smashed them 3-0.
This was the third straight game Atletico played that saw over 2.5 goals. Also, it was the first one this year in which they haven’t scored at least twice. The saga around Julian Alvarez is over, but the turbulence in the player-fans relationship remains.
Liverpool vs. Atletico Madrid Head to Head
The Reds were better in 2025, when they won at home, 3-2. Robertson, Salah and Van Dijk netted for Liverpool, while Marcos Llorente added two goals for the Madridians.
